When Claremont Group Interiors became employee owned in December 2020, people were initially highly sceptical about what it actually meant.
Since then, Claremont Group Interiors have focused on succession planning and rewarding the efforts and contributions of the 125-strong team. Whilst it’s not been plane sailing, it has opened up opportunities to leverage the benefits of being employee owned.
Their people first approach has led to pre-tax profits of £3m in the first year of being employee owned, almost double their previous best performance.
